Nagaland is located in the northeastern part of India, near the Myanmar border. Songs are always echoing in the rice terraces that spread there. While farming, the villagers sing about the richness of the changing seasons, songs of friendship, and everything else in life. A music documentary work that quietly fascinates with beautiful nature and echoing singing voices.
(2017 / India / 83 min / Chalkley / BD / Japanese subtitles)
